Overview
This examination will focus on testing the fundamentals of civil engineering. The 6-hour examination will comprise two parts. Part 1 catering for breadth, will comprise questions on core civil engineering subjects, typical of courses covered during civil engineering undergraduate course. Part 2 catering for depth, will comprise more design aspects of civil engineering courses during undergraduate.
For FEE (Civil) 2022, only answers based on Eurocodes and the relevant Singapore Annexes will be accepted. Answers based on other codes and standards will not be accepted.
Format
FEE Part 1 (Civil) (3 hours and 10 minutes) – 40 MCQ questions
- CE101 Mechanics of Materials
- CE102 Structural Mechanics
- CE103 Structural Analysis
- CE104 Soil Mechanics
- CE105 Fluid Mechanics
FEE Part 2 (Civil) (3 hours and 10 minutes) – 5 out of 9 questions
- CE201 Reinforced and Prestressed Concrete Structures (2 Qs)
- CE202 Steel and Composite Structures (2 Qs)
- CE203 Geotechnical Engineering (2 Qs)
- CE204 Transportation (1 Q)
- CE205 Hydraulic and Hydrology (1 Q)
- CE206 Environmental Engineering (1 Q)
